#f070d9 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#f070d9 is composed of 94.1% red, 43.9% green and 85.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 53.3% magenta, 9.6% yellow and 5.9% black. It has a hue angle of 310.8 degrees, a saturation of 81% and a lightness of 69%. #f070d9 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ffe0ff with #e100b3. Closest websafe color is: #ff66cc.

#f070d9 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#f070d9 has RGB values of R:240, G:112, B:217 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.53, Y:0.1, K:0.06. Its decimal value is 15757529.

Hex triplet f070d9 #f070d9
RGB Decimal 240, 112, 217 rgb(240,112,217)
RGB Percent 94.1, 43.9, 85.1 rgb(94.1%,43.9%,85.1%)
CMYK 0, 53, 10, 6
HSL 310.8°, 81, 69 hsl(310.8,81%,69%)
HSV (or HSB) 310.8°, 53.3, 94.1
Web Safe ff66cc #ff66cc
CIE-LAB 65.847, 61.972, -31.14
XYZ 54.253, 35.127, 69.564
xyY 0.341, 0.221, 35.127
CIE-LCH 65.847, 69.356, 333.322
CIE-LUV 65.847, 65.838, -58.279
Hunter-Lab 59.268, 59.679, -28.103
Binary 11110000, 01110000, 11011001

Shades and Tints of #f070d9

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#11020e is the darkest color, while #fffeff is the lightest one.

Tones of #f070d9

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#b3adb2 is the less saturated color, while #fc64e1 is the most saturated one.
